  1. Bo Christensen (24 August 1937 – 11 April 2020) was a Danish film producer. Christensen is best known for producing Babette's Feast (1987), for which he won the Best Foreign Film Oscar and the BAFTA Best Foreign Film award in 1988.

  5. Bo T. Christensen, Ph.D. is Professor of Design Research at Copenhagen Business School. A cognitive psychologist by training, his works center on cognitive studies of creative, innovative or entrepreneurial practices in the fields of design, business, architecture, engineering, and gastronomy.
